3.8 v6 to 302 or 351

I am trying to find out what i need to to put a 302 or 351 into my 87 Cougar with a 3.8 v6.

3.8 v6 to 302 or 351

Reply #1
You'll need the uber rare engine mount brackets for an '86-'88 Fox Tbird/Cougar. (Or order Chuck W's custom made mounts. Best option)
The proper year engine harness.
Obviously, the engine, and all necessary parts.
The fuel lines are different, in regards to 3.8 vs 5.0 cars, in regards to how they enter the engine bay.

If going with a 351w, you'll also need the Windsor/Fox swap pan and pickup.

These are the basics...it gets deeper when you get to the electronics...staying efi, or going back to the stone age with a carburetor?
if efi, you'll need at least a 5.0HO equivalent fuel pump, the required EEC, and of course the aforementioned engine harness.
I wouldn't bother with putting a carb 5.0 in....you can swap in a Mustang 5.0HO and make more power, more reliably, with less hassle.

A 351w will cost a good bit more to keep efi, but a few guys here have done that on a budget and come out with pretty good power. Search 1Sick88Tbird's posts on his 5.8 swap...
